Transaction 342093af3ec80ef181ef3aa5f02042f95217ce8ace46f75b1a43449e4ae15824

block
7bd484b427cf2b969c678f55a8debf99c951320639400a66f2d1f9b9d1270322

1 Input

3 Outputs